# Harborline partner SFTP drop — env config
# Context for the weekly eng sync: the Velmere partner feed lands
# nightly at 01:30 and the poller below must authenticate before
# pickup, or files queue until morning. Host and path are set
# upstream; only the credential lives here. The required line is:

sealed setting: VAULT_KEY20=69e2a0b23f1a79fbf692

**Action Item 4: Audit the Tidygrove stale-branch bot's deletion criteria**

During the incident, the bot deleted a release branch that had been inactive for 91 days but was still referenced by the Bramblehurst deployment pipeline. Reviewer should verify the proposed patch adds a protected-pattern check *before* the age check, not after, and that the dry-run flag defaults to on for any branch matching release or hotfix prefixes. Include test cases for each pattern. The bot's current configuration and protection rules are documented here:

operations page: https://confluence.tolvaqsys.corp/spaces/pages/pages/6e787158f507

14:22 — Import job for the Branmoor Library catalogue stalled halfway through the periodicals batch. Turns out the MARC parser choked on a record with a duplicate control field and just... stopped, no error. Restarted with the skip-malformed flag and it chewed through the rest in twenty minutes. We should add a dead-letter queue for bad records instead of silent stalls. The stalled worker logged a trace reference right before freezing, captured below.

session token of kageg-tahop = htk14_af3c1ccccb7dcf

Visitor Policy — Brindlewick Pop-Up Office, Harvane Expo Hall

For the duration of the Harvane trade fair, our pop-up office on Stand 14 operates a strict escort rule. All visitors must be met at the stand perimeter by a Brindlewick staff member, signed into the paper log, and issued a red lanyard before entering the demo booth or the back office. Lanyards must be returned at departure and counted at close of day. The rear storage cabin stays locked at all times; to open it, facilities staff should enter the following code.

staff pass of kawip-hawef = bdg-QLP-2